Former Bayern Munich coach Hansi Flick's preference for quicker midfielders led to Angelo Stiller's departure, despite efforts by the management to keep him at the club.
Angelo Stiller's situation highlights a missed opportunity for Bayern Munich to develop a talented player, as the team's midfield was struggling during his tenure.
After moving to Hoffenheim and then to VfB Stuttgart, Angelo Stiller demonstrated his potential, becoming an effective player in a top league and aiming for the World Cup.
Stiller's self-belief and determination have been crucial in his career, proving that he could become a Bundesliga starter when given the opportunity.
